在vue项目中安装flv.js文件
npm i flv.js --save
将flv.js文件导入相关组件中。
创建video元素标签来播放视频内容。
flvjs.isSupported()是否支持,若支持。则 flvjs.createPlayer创建flv播放器对象,加载到video元素中进行播放即可
参考文档
https://www.bysb.net/2943.html
https://blog.csdn.net/weixin_45316326/article/details/99053910
浏览器不支持自动全屏播放,全屏播放的操作需要用户触发。Flv.js在JavaScript中流式解析flv文件流,并实时转封装为fmp4,通过MediaSourceExtensions喂给浏览器,实现了FLV格式视频的播放。
Bilibili相信大家都不会陌生,而Flv.js就是由bilibili网站开源的HTML5Flash视频(FLV)播放器,纯原生JavaScript开发(ECMAScript6编写)。